What is the purpose of the Endangered Species Act?

The Endangered Species Act was made law to help protect animals and plants that were in danger of becoming extinct.

What did DDT do that caused the bald eagle to become endangered?

DDT made the eagles' eggshells weak, so they often broke before the chick could hatch.

Since people started to get hurt in bear encounters, what changes did Yellowstone National Park enact?

1. Keep people on trails

2. Keep some areas wild - only for bears

3. Removed the dumps

4. Help people keep people food and trash away from bears
